Project Snapshot

✨ Skill Level: Advanced Beginner to Intermediate

✨ Time Investment: Approximately 12 to 15 hours

✨ Finished Size: The maiden stands roughly 28cm tall, and the feline at 10cm, depending on your tension.

Materials

🧶 Premium velvet or chenille yarn in Skin Tone, Rust/Auburn, Brown, White, Green, Red, and Pink.

🧶 2.5mm crochet hook (or size appropriate to achieve a tight, gapless fabric).

🧶 10mm black safety eyes for the maiden.

🧶 8mm black safety eyes for the feline.

🧶 Polyfill stuffing.

🪡 Yarn needle for precise assembly.

Abbreviations

➡️ mr: magic ring

➡️ sc: single crochet

➡️ inc: increase (2 sc in one stitch)

➡️ dec: decrease (invisible decrease preferred)

➡️ hdc: half double crochet

➡️ dc: double crochet

➡️ ch: chain

➡️ sl st: slip stitch

➡️ BLO: back loops only

The Pattern

The Maiden: Head

🧶 Round 1: 6 sc in mr (6)

🧶 Round 2: 6 inc (12)

🧶 Round 3: [1 sc, 1 inc] x 6 (18)

🧶 Round 4: [2 sc, 1 inc] x 6 (24)

🧶 Round 5: [3 sc, 1 inc] x 6 (30)

🧶 Round 6: [4 sc, 1 inc] x 6 (36)

🧶 Round 7: [5 sc, 1 inc] x 6 (42)

🧶 Round 8: [6 sc, 1 inc] x 6 (48)

🧶 Round 9: [7 sc, 1 inc] x 6 (54)

🧶 Rounds 10-15: sc around (54)

Place 10mm safety eyes between Rounds 14 and 15, ensuring exactly 9 stitches remain visible between them.

🧶 Round 16 (Cheek Shaping): 15 sc, [1 inc, 1 sc] x 4, 8 sc, [1 sc, 1 inc] x 4, 15 sc (62)

🧶 Rounds 17-19: sc around (62)

🧶 Round 20: 15 sc, [1 dec, 1 sc] x 4, 8 sc, [1 sc, 1 dec] x 4, 15 sc (54)

🧶 Round 21: [7 sc, 1 dec] x 6 (48)

🧶 Round 22: [6 sc, 1 dec] x 6 (42)

🧶 Round 23: [5 sc, 1 dec] x 6 (36)

🧶 Round 24: [4 sc, 1 dec] x 6 (30)

Begin stuffing the head firmly, paying special attention to pushing polyfill into the lower cheek cavities.

🧶 Round 25: [3 sc, 1 dec] x 6 (24)

🧶 Round 26: [2 sc, 1 dec] x 6 (18)

🧶 Round 27: [1 sc, 1 dec] x 6 (12)

🧶 Fasten off, leaving a long tail for sewing.

The Maiden: Hair Base & Ringlets (Rust/Auburn)

🧶 Round 1: 6 sc in mr (6)

🧶 Round 2: 6 inc (12)

🧶 Round 3: [1 sc, 1 inc] x 6 (18)

🧶 Round 4: [2 sc, 1 inc] x 6 (24)

🧶 Round 5: [3 sc, 1 inc] x 6 (30)

🧶 Round 6: [4 sc, 1 inc] x 6 (36)

🧶 Round 7: [5 sc, 1 inc] x 6 (42)

🧶 Round 8: [6 sc, 1 inc] x 6 (48)

🧶 Round 9: [7 sc, 1 inc] x 6 (54)

🧶 Round 10: [chain 40, sc down the chain 39 times, sl st into next sc of base] repeat this sequence 54 times to create a full head of ringlets.

🧶 Fasten off, leaving a very long tail to secure the wig to the head.

The Maiden: Legs (Make 2)

Start with Brown yarn for the shoes.

🧶 Round 1: 6 sc in mr (6)

🧶 Round 2: 6 inc (12)

🧶 Round 3: [1 sc, 1 inc] x 6 (18)

🧶 Round 4: sc around in BLO (18)

🧶 Rounds 5-6: sc around (18)

🧶 Round 7: 6 sc, 3 dec, 6 sc (15)

Change to White yarn.

🧶 Rounds 8-10: sc around (15)

Change to Green yarn.

🧶 Rounds 11-12: sc around (15)

Alternate between White and Green every two rounds until you complete Round 18. Fasten off the first leg. Do not fasten off the second leg.

The Maiden: Body

Continuing from the second leg with White yarn.

🧶 Round 19: 15 sc on the first leg, 15 sc on the second leg (30)

Change to Red yarn.

🧶 Round 20: [4 sc, 1 inc] x 6 (36)

🧶 Rounds 21-25: sc around (36)

🧶 Round 26: [4 sc, 1 dec] x 6 (30)

🧶 Rounds 27-30: sc around (30)

🧶 Round 31: [3 sc, 1 dec] x 6 (24)

🧶 Rounds 32-34: sc around (24)

🧶 Round 35: [2 sc, 1 dec] x 6 (18)

🧶 Round 36: [1 sc, 1 dec] x 6 (12)

🧶 Fasten off. Stuff the body firmly, ensuring the neck is highly supported.

The Maiden: Arms (Make 2)

Start with Skin Tone.

🧶 Round 1: 6 sc in mr (6)

🧶 Round 2: [1 sc, 1 inc] x 3 (9)

🧶 Rounds 3-4: sc around (9)

Change to Red yarn.

🧶 Rounds 5-16: sc around (9)

🧶 Fasten off, leaving a tail for sewing. Lightly stuff the lower half of the arms; leave the top flat.

The Maiden: Pinafore Apron (White)

This piece is worked flat in rows.

🧶 Row 1: Ch 31, sc in 2nd ch from hook and across (30)

🧶 Rows 2-6: ch 1, turn, sc across (30)

🧶 Row 7 (Ruffle): ch 1, turn, [2 dc in each st] across (60)

🧶 Straps: Attach yarn to top right corner, ch 15, fasten off. Repeat for the top left corner.

The Maiden: Beret (Pink)

🧶 Round 1: 8 sc in mr (8)

🧶 Round 2: 8 inc (16)

🧶 Round 3: [1 sc, 1 inc] x 8 (24)

🧶 Round 4: [2 sc, 1 inc] x 8 (32)

🧶 Round 5: [3 sc, 1 inc] x 8 (40)

🧶 Round 6: [4 sc, 1 inc] x 8 (48)

🧶 Round 7: [5 sc, 1 inc] x 8 (56)

🧶 Round 8: [6 sc, 1 inc] x 8 (64)

🧶 Round 9: [7 sc, 1 inc] x 8 (72)

🧶 Round 10: [8 sc, 1 inc] x 8 (80)

🧶 Rounds 11-14: sc around (80)

🧶 Round 15: [8 sc, 1 dec] x 8 (72)

🧶 Round 16: [7 sc, 1 dec] x 8 (64)

🧶 Round 17: [6 sc, 1 dec] x 8 (56)

🧶 Round 18: [5 sc, 1 dec] x 8 (48)

🧶 Round 19: sc around (48)

🧶 Fasten off. Embroider small berry motifs using red and green yarn before attaching to the head.

The Feline: Head (Pink)

🧶 Round 1: 6 sc in mr (6)

🧶 Round 2: 6 inc (12)

🧶 Round 3: [1 sc, 1 inc] x 6 (18)

🧶 Round 4: [2 sc, 1 inc] x 6 (24)

🧶 Round 5: [3 sc, 1 inc] x 6 (30)

🧶 Round 6: [4 sc, 1 inc] x 6 (36)

🧶 Rounds 7-12: sc around (36)

Place 8mm safety eyes between Rounds 9 and 10, exactly 8 stitches apart.

🧶 Round 13: [4 sc, 1 dec] x 6 (30)

🧶 Round 14: [3 sc, 1 dec] x 6 (24)

🧶 Round 15: [2 sc, 1 dec] x 6 (18)

🧶 Round 16: [1 sc, 1 dec] x 6 (12)

🧶 Fasten off. Stuff firmly.

The Feline: Body (Pink)

🧶 Round 1: 6 sc in mr (6)

🧶 Round 2: 6 inc (12)

🧶 Round 3: [1 sc, 1 inc] x 6 (18)

🧶 Round 4: [2 sc, 1 inc] x 6 (24)

🧶 Rounds 5-8: sc around (24)

🧶 Round 9: [2 sc, 1 dec] x 6 (18)

🧶 Rounds 10-11: sc around (18)

🧶 Fasten off. Stuff firmly to create a plump belly.

The Feline: Ears (Make 2)

🧶 Round 1: 4 sc in mr (4)

🧶 Round 2: [1 sc, 1 inc] x 2 (6)

🧶 Round 3: [2 sc, 1 inc] x 2 (8)

🧶 Fasten off. Do not stuff.

The Feline: Limbs (Make 4)

🧶 Round 1: 6 sc in mr (6)

🧶 Rounds 2-4: sc around (6)

🧶 Fasten off.

The Feline: Tail

🧶 Round 1: 4 sc in mr (4)

🧶 Rounds 2-6: sc around (4)

🧶 Fasten off.

Assembly Instructions

🪡 The Maiden: Securely sew the head to the body at Round 36 of the neck.

🪡 Pin the hair base to the top of the head, aligning the center ring with the magic ring of the head, and sew it down firmly.

🪡 Attach the arms to the sides of the body between Rounds 34 and 35, ensuring they point slightly inward.

🪡 Wrap the pinafore apron around her waist, crossing the straps in the back and securing them to the waistband.

🪡 Sew the beret onto the hair, slightly tilted to one side for an elegant profile.

🪡 The Feline: Sew the head to the body.

🪡 Pinch the ears flat and sew them to the top of the head between Rounds 3 and 6.

🪡 Attach the upper limbs just below the neck seam, and the lower limbs at the base of the body to allow the feline to sit upright.

🪡 Sew the tail to the lower back center. Use black embroidery thread to stitch the nose, whiskers, and dashed accent lines across the body. Finish by tying a small green ribbon around the neck.
